《数据库原理及应用 Access2003》PDF下载

  • 购买积分:12 如何计算积分?
  • 作  者:庞振平主编
  • 出 版 社:广州:华南理工大学出版社
  • 出版年份:2011
  • ISBN:9787562334088
  • 页数:313 页
图书介绍:本书共六章:第1章数据库系统概述,第2章关系数据库,第3章关系数据库设计理论,第4章关系数据库标准语言SQL,第5章关系数据库管理系统-ACCESS,第6章数据库设计。

第1章 数据库系统概述 1

1.1基本概念 1

1.1.1数据、信息与数据处理 1

1.1.2数据库 4

1.1.3数据库管理系统 4

1.1.4数据库系统 8

1.2数据库管理技术的产生与发展 11

1.2.1人工管理阶段 12

1.2.2文件系统阶段 13

1.2.3数据库系统阶段 14

1.3数据库系统结构 16

1.3.1数据库系统的模式结构 17

1.3.2数据库系统的外部体系结构 19

1.4数据模型 22

1.4.1数据模型的分类 22

1.4.2数据模型的组成 22

1.4.3概念数据模型 23

1.4.4逻辑数据模型 27

1.4.5数据模型与数据库系统的发展 33

1.5小结 34

习题 35

第2章 关系数据库 38

2.1关系数据库概述 38

2.1.1关系的定义 38

2.1.2关系模式 41

2.1.3关系数据库 42

2.1.4关系的完整性约束 43

2.2关系代数 45

2.2.1传统的集合运算 46

2.2.2专门关系运算 48

2.3关系数据库管理系统 53

2.3.1 Oracle 53

2.3.2 DB2 54

2.3.3 Sybase 55

2.3.4 MySQL 56

2.3.5 Access 57

2.4小结 58

习题 58

第3章 关系数据库设计理论 62

3.1关系模式设计中的问题 62

3.2数据依赖 63

3.2.1函数依赖 64

3.2.2几种特殊的函数依赖 66

3.2.3*逻辑蕴涵 66

3.3范式 67

3.3.1第一范式(1NF) 68

3.3.2第二范式(2NF) 69

3.3.3第三范式(3NF) 70

3.3.4 *BCNF范式 71

3.3.5 *多值函数依赖 72

3.3.6 *第四范式(4NF) 73

3.4关系模式的规范化 74

3.4.1关系模式规范化步骤 74

3.4.2 *关系模式的分解 75

3.5小结 76

习题 77

第4章 关系数据库标准语言SQL 80

4.1 SQL概述 80

4.1.1 SQL语言的发展及特点 80

4.1.2 SQL语言的基本概念 81

4.2 SQL的数据定义 83

4.2.1创建与删除数据库 83

4.2.2创建、修改与删除基本表 84

4.2.3创建与删除索引 89

4.3 SQL的数据查询 91

4.3.1单表查询 93

4.3.2连接查询 104

4.3.3嵌套查询 108

4.3.4组合查询 114

4.4 SQL的数据更新 116

4.4.1插入数据 116

4.4.2删除数据 119

4.4.3修改数据 120

4.5视图 120

4.5.1创建与删除视图 121

4.5.2查询视图 123

4.5.3更新视图 123

4.6 SQL的数据控制 124

4.6.1权限的授予 125

4.6.2权限的收回 127

4.7小结 128

习题 128

第5章 关系数据库管理系统——Access 132

5.1 Access概述 132

5.1.1 Access的特点 132

5.1.2建立数据库 132

5.1.3打开数据库与关闭数据库 138

5.2数据表 140

5.2.1 Access数据类型 140

5.2.2创建一个新表 141

5.2.3表的打开与关闭 152

5.2.4维护表结构 152

5.2.5维护表记录 153

5.2.6字段属性的设置 155

5.2.7建立表之间的关联 159

5.3数据查询 162

5.3.1认识查询 162

5.3.2创建选择查询 165

5.3.3创建交叉表查询 173

5.3.4创建参数查询 180

5.3.5创建操作查询 182

5.3.6创建SQL查询 190

5.3.7查询结果排序 191

5.4窗体设计 193

5.4.1窗体的概念 193

5.4.2窗体的结构 193

5.4.3窗体的分类 194

5.4.4创建窗体 199

5.4.5窗体和控件的属性 244

5.5报表设计 245

5.5.1报表的概念 245

5.5.2报表的结构 245

5.5.3报表的分类 246

5.5.4创建报表 247

5.6数据访问页 263

5.6.1概述 263

5.6.2创建数据访问页 263

5.7宏操作 270

5.7.1宏的概述 270

5.7.2创建宏与宏组 272

5.7.3宏的执行 279

5.7.4宏的调试 280

5.8面向对象的程序设计语言——VBA 280

5.8.1 VBA程序设计基础 280

5.8.2 VBA的常用语句 284

5.8.3模块基本概念 288

5.8.4过程及过程调用 289

5.8.5创建VBA模块 291

5.8.6转换已有的宏为VBA过程 295

5.9小结 297

习题 298

第6章 数据库设计 302

6.1数据库设计概述 302

6.1.1数据库设计概念 302

6.1.2数据库设计的基本步骤 303

6.2需求分析 303

6.2.1需求分析的任务 303

6.2.2需求分析的方法 303

6.2.3数据字典 304

6.3概念结构设计 305

6.3.1概念结构设计的基本方法 305

6.3.2概念结构设计的步骤 306

6.4逻辑结构设计 307

6.4.1 E-R模式到关系模式的转换 307

6.4.2关系模式的优化 308

6.5数据库物理设计 308

6.5.1聚簇设计 309

6.5.2索引设计 309

6.5.3 HASH存取设计 309

6.6数据库实施与维护 310

6.6.1数据库系统的试运行 311

6.6.2数据库系统的运行与维护 311

6.7小结 311

习题 312